Transaction e31f63a0a500838e753376ddbbd3fb608129542043b0912057cf9066f982e4d5

1 Input
2 Outputs
  • e31f63a0a500838e753376ddbbd3fb608129542043b0912057cf9066f982e4d5:0
  • value  38441675
    address  15fr2Rqt8hSG36hiZi8rnPRKrJCFxWpXvK
  • e31f63a0a500838e753376ddbbd3fb608129542043b0912057cf9066f982e4d5:1
  • value  60000
    address  13m7CxcSuDNLxF47DvEBT1KBUnfEGKbA8v